The ingredients needed to prepare Dorayaki with Peanut Butter:

  1. Take 1 cup of Self-Raising Flour.
  2. Provide 2 of Eggs.
  3. Use 1/2 cup of Sugar.
  4. Use 1/2 cup of Water about.
  5. You need of ‘Tsubu-an’ (Sweet Azuki Paste).
  6. Provide of Crunchy Peanut Butter.

Instructions to make Dorayaki with Peanut Butter:

  1. Make thin 10cm pancakes with least possible Oil. Non stick pan is recommended as you need no Oil..
  2. *Note: This pancake batter is specially for ‘Dorayaki’. Because of the larger amount of sugar, it would be easy to burn quickly. Please cook on low heat and try to make one side brown. The other side doesn’t require to be browned..
  3. Sandwich 1 tablespoons of Tsubu-an and 1 tablespoons of Crunchy Peanut Butter with two pancakes..
